Owing to space problems, and cold winter, I have a choice of either assembling my motor now, and waiting to install and start until spring OR assembling in spring, but having all the motor parts lying about, possibly getting contaminated with dirt, or lost THe question is, will the assembly lube hold in the various places sufficiently for , say 3 months? I have this Lucas engine assembly lube. THanks |

Sitting for that long assembled shouldn't be a problem. I save silica gel desiccant pouches for situations like these. Get a very large heavy-duty garbage bag and bag the motor with a decent size desiccant bag to absorb any moisture. The most critical wear area on a new or rebuilt engine is the cam to lifter interface. Be sure to lube the cam lobes and lifters well. Don't rotate the engine until you're ready to start it so the lube stays on the cam lobes. |
